Introducing AHEPA 192 IV Senior Apartments! Opening this summer, we are pleased to announce we are accepting pre-application submissions of interest for AHEPA 192 IV! 

 

Ideally located, AHEPA 192 IV Senior Apartments is a new 90-unit community for very low-income seniors, ages 62 and older, that is subsidized by the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) Section 202 Supportive Housing for the Elderly program.

As a mission-driven organization with roots in giving back to the community, our focus is on our residents, their families, and the communities in which we live and serve. Since 1996, AHEPA Senior Living has supported nonprofits to an amount that exceeds $9 million. We have contributed to nonprofits that provide service dogs for veterans, provide services to survivors of domestic violence, advance opportunities for access to education, bolster critical at-home nutritional services for vulnerable seniors, support programs that empower women, and provide comprehensive vision care support for the blind and visually impaired communities.
